How to Choose a Business Location: 8 Factors to Consider

  1. Decide on a business location type.
  2. Make sure the business location is within your budget.
  3. Consider your brand.
  4. Think about vendors and suppliers.
  5. Find a safe location.
  6. Go where there is demand.
  7. Think about recruiting efforts.
  8. Look for sites with parking options.

How do I open up a business?

  1. Step 1: Choose the Right Business Idea.
  2. Step 2: Plan Your Business.
  3. Step 3: Get Funding.
  4. Step 4: Choose a Business Structure.
  5. Step 5: Form Your Business.
  6. Step 6: Set up Business Banking, Credit Cards, and Accounting.
  7. Step 7: Get Insured.
  8. Step 8: Obtain Permits and Licenses.

What is poor location?

According to SBA studies, poor location is among the chief causes of all business failures. In determining a site for a retail operation, you must be willing to pay for a good location. The cost of the location often reflects the volume and/or quality of the business you will generate.

What is the easiest business?

The easiest business to start is a service business, especially for a beginner. A service business is any kind of business where you sell services. In other words, you sell your skill, labor or expertise — instead of products or goods.

What to know when starting a business?

Some of the things you need to know about you business may be based on the particulars of your business. For example, if you’re starting an online business, you’ll need to know about domain names, websites and web hosting. If you’re starting a retail store, you’ll want to know about locations, leases and inventory.
